Rush Services Qualifications Robert S. Gartrell, CBA, ASA
Robert S. Gartrell is currently a principal of Legal Economic Evaluations which offers various economic valuation studies and appraisals of business entities. Gartrell brings to his clients a unique combination of professional appraisal and financial analysis skills. He has provided economic analysis of business damages, lost wages, lost benefits including lost employee stock options that have been used in various general liability, medical malpractice, and other tort cases to calculate the loss of earnings. The firm,, Legal Economic Evaluations, and Gartrell are actively involved in economic evaluations in many states throughout the United States and provide expert opinion on pension plan valuations and litigation economics. Robert Gartrell is a Certified Business Appraiser, a professional designation awarded by the Institute of Business Appraisers. He is also an Accredited Senior Appraiser certified in Business Valuation, a professional designation awarded by the American Society of Appraisers. He is one of only about 70 individuals in the U.S. to be certified in Business Valuation by both the ASA and IBA. Gartrell is qualified by virtue of his training, skill, experience, and professional credentials to appraise the Fair Market Value of going concerns, minority interests, goodwill, intangible assets, and other entities. He has valued many businesses for various purposes including Employee Stock Ownership Plans, merger and acquisitions, litigation, incoming, gift and estate tax purposes. Gartrell is recognized as an expert in the valuation of community property business assets, such as family businesses, farming ventures, limited partnerships, and professional practices, in addition to economic damages. He has provided expert testimony in various Superior Courts in California, Idaho, and Alaska. He has published journal articles and has spoken at local, state, and national meetings of various professional groups on the subject of business valuation and litigation economics. EDUCATION

Kathleen P. Hudgins
Kathleen P. Hudgins is currently the senior pension consultant at Legal Economic Evaluations (LEE) which offers various economic valuation studies and analysis for use by the legal community. Ms. Hudgins brings to her clients a combination of professional and financial analysis skills with over thirty years of experience in financial accounting, auditing, statistical data, as well as benefits administration. Ms. Hudgins is actively involved in providing economic analysis services, litigation economics, and the valuation and apportionment of various benefit plans throughout the United States. On average, LEE provides between 800 and 1000 pension evaluations per year. Ms. Hudgins has been certified as a COBRA administrator by COBRA Compliance Systems in compliance with the National State Board of Accountancy, and is a qualified administrator for Workers Compensation and Injured and Disabled Employee programs. Her background includes several years working for the US Federal Government Bureau of Labor Statistics providing economic data for the Cost of Living Index. She was a senior benefit plan administrator for Pal Plastics, Inc., Haro Distributing, Inc., and Jessee Heating & Air Conditioning. Ms. Hudgins was a office analyst for one of the largest, privately run US Government installations, Hawthorne Army Depot. Her experience also includes benefit plans auditor for Indian Enterprise Rancherias in California. Hudgins has been qualified as an expert witness regarding pension plan evaluations. ORGANIZATIONS
